bichthao Posted June 17, 2012 Share Posted June 17, 2012 Dear all, I really need your suggestion on my case. I am 30 year old lady, holding a Vietnamese passport. I applied visa after my marriage with Thai husband, and I renew visa each year. My last one year visa will be end this coming Aug, 2012 --> I need to go for renew about July, 2012. My passport will be expired on 2018, however, because I have travelled a lot therefore most of the page of passport was filled, there is about 2 pages left. I would like to go to Vnese embassy to make a new one. I would like to make it first before going to renew visa in July Since all visa as well as departure cards are with the current passport, if I make new passport, does my visa become invalid and how can I renew my one year visa with the new passport???? lopburi3 Posted June 18, 2012 Share Posted June 18, 2012 Just get your new passport and then visit immigration to transfer your current one year extension of stay and visa information into your new passport (no charge and one short form to fill out). Your Embassy may give you a letter asking for this service but if not (some like the UK Embassy will not provide) immigration should understand and do for you. Copies of your old passport data page/visa and extensions will be required and a copy of new passport data page.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

wolfgangbkk Posted June 18, 2012 Share Posted June 18, 2012 Your passport will be canceled by the embassy upon receiving a new one. However, Visa remains valid which must be transferred into your new book which can be done by the immigration that permitted you last extension. You must have a letter from the embassy because immigration will ask for it.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
lopburi3 Posted June 18, 2012 Share Posted June 18, 2012 Actually the visa is not transferred, only the information about it and from where and the extension of stay will be in the new passport. If your Embassy does not issue a letter it will not be required. I know UK never provides from many reports here and now they do not even issue the passports.
